Abstract

The invention discloses a distributor pipe welding machine, comprising an end cover fixing device, a pipe body fixing device, an infrared heating device and a machine stand, wherein the end cover fixing device and the pipe body fixing device are oppositely arranged on the machine stand and can move left and right oppositely to realize butt joint; the infrared heating device is arranged between the end cover fixing device and the pipe fixing device and can move front and back. According to the distributor pipe welding machine, the infrared heating device is used for heating welding, a welded part is not adhered to a heating plate, the heating effect is uniform, time consumption is short, weld joints are small, the welding strength is high, the operation is stable, all the components can be mounted and dismounted conveniently and quickly, the adjustment is flexible and convenient, the productivity can be improved effectively, and the production cost is lowered.

Background technology
Oil distributing pipe is made up of end cap and body, end cap and body is needed to utilize solder technology to be welded together, conventional processing mode is from fusion welding, but current needs to make corresponding mould for the shape of solder side from fusion welding technology, mould is by making its surface melting with feature contacts after heater plate, part docking being exerted pressure makes it weld again, the specific aim of this processing mode is poor, the different part of processing is needed to process different moulds, consuming cost is large, and by heating solder side again after heating mould during heating, this indirectly mode of heating heat time is longer, and the heat of loss is large, cause production efficiency low, energy resource consumption is large, handling part is complicated, operation inconvenience.

Detailed description of the invention
Below in conjunction with accompanying drawing, the present invention is described.
Accompanying drawing 1,2 is a kind of oil distributing pipe bonding machine of the present invention, comprises end-cap fixture 1, body fixture 2, infrared heating device 3 and board 5; Described end-cap fixture 1 and body fixture 2 are oppositely arranged on board 5, and end-cap fixture 1 and body fixture 2 can left and right relative movements, achieve a butt joint; Be provided with infrared heating device 3 between end-cap fixture 1 and body fixture 2, described infrared heating device 3 can move forward and backward; Described bonding machine also comprises abnormal article collection box 4, and described abnormal article collection box is provided with optical grating detecting instrument 41; First end cap and body are separately fixed in end-cap fixture 1 and body fixture 2, then the first pre-docking of end-cap fixture 1 and body fixture 2 once, record the displacement before processing, end-cap fixture 1 and body fixture 2 are separated again, return separately, the infrared heating device 3 alignment element solder side that advances heats, after completing heating, infrared heating device 3 is return, end-cap fixture 1 and body fixture 2 are docked and are welded, record the displacement after welding again, like this so that product back-tracing respectively processes the processing situation of period; If there is abnormal alarm in board, this abnormal article is needed to put in abnormal article collection box 4, after optical grating detecting instrument 41 in abnormal article collection box 4 detects abnormal article, bonding machine just can normally start again, operation mistiming is avoided abnormal article again to be processed like this, produce defective products, affect product quality.
As shown in Figure 3,4, described end-cap fixture 1 comprises end cap displacement transducer 11, end cap guide rail 12, end cap drive unit 13, end cap buffer unit 14 and end cover fixture 15, described end cover fixture 15 comprises end cover fixture backboard 151, lateral adjustments plate 152, longitudinal adjustable plate 153 and vacuum suction 154, end cover fixture backboard 151 is disposed with lateral adjustments plate 152, longitudinal adjustable plate 153, vacuum suction 154, described lateral adjustments plate 152 comprises 2 the lateral adjustments buttons 1521 in left and right, and described lateral adjustments button 1521 is arranged on the left of lateral adjustments plate 152 and right side, is fixed on end cover fixture backboard 151, described longitudinal adjustable plate 153 comprises upper and lower 2 longitudinal adjusting knobs 1531, and longitudinal adjusting knob 1531 is arranged on above and below longitudinal adjustable plate 153, is fixed on longitudinal adjustable plate 153, described vacuum suction 154 comprises 2 Level tune buttons 1541, described end cap buffer unit 14 is arranged on end cap guide rail 12, the rear end of described end cap guide rail 12 is provided with end cap drive unit 13, and described end cover fixture 15 is arranged on the front end of end cap buffer unit 14, first end cap is contained in vacuum suction 154, device vacuumizes and is fixed on end cover fixture 15 by end cap, lateral adjustments plate 152 can be carried out left and right fine setting by regulating lateral adjustments button 1521, by regulating longitudinal adjusting knob 1531, longitudinal adjustable plate about 153 is finely tuned, the levelness of end cap is regulated by regulating flat adjusting knob 1541, align to protect end cap central position, end cap drive unit 13 Driving terminal fixture 15 slides on end cap guide rail 12, dock with body fixture 2 and welded action, lid displacement transducer 11 records displacement data, end cap buffer unit 14 plays cushioning effect when pressure is excessive when welding, avoid that pressure is excessive causes damage to part, guarantee welding quality.
As shown in Figure 5, described body fixture 2 comprises body displacement transducer 21, body guide rail 22, body slide block 23, body drive unit 24 and body fixture 25; Described body fixture 25 comprises body fixture backboard 251, body ambulatory splint 252, clamping plate control spanner 253 and spanner connecting rod 254, body fixture backboard 251 is provided with on body ambulatory splint 252, one end of described spanner connecting rod 254 is connected with body ambulatory splint 252, and the other end and clamping plate control spanner 253 and are connected; The right-hand member of described body guide rail 22 is provided with body drive unit 24, and described body slide block 23 is arranged on body guide rail 22, and described body fixture 25 is arranged on the front end of body slide block 23; When needing peace loading and unloading to get body, first moving clamping plate control spanner 253 makes body ambulatory splint 252 be in movable state, move clamping plate after installing body and control spanner 253, body ambulatory splint 252 is made to be in tightening state, body is fixing by body fixture 25, described body drive unit 24 drives body slide block 23 to move, body slide block 23 drives body fixture 25 to slide on body guide rail 22, docked with end-cap fixture 1 and welded action, body displacement transducer 21 records displacement data.
As shown in figs 6-8, described infrared heating device 3 comprises heater removable drive 31, heater guide rail 32, infrared heater 33 and infrared temperature detector 34, described infrared heater 33 has 2, one corresponding with end-cap fixture 1, one corresponding with body fixture 2, described infrared temperature detector 34 has 2, one corresponding with end-cap fixture 1, and one corresponding with body fixture 2, and described heater removable drive 31 is arranged on the rear end of heater guide rail 32, described infrared heater 33 is arranged on heater guide rail 32, and the front end of described infrared heater 33 is provided with infrared temperature detector 34, described red heater 33 comprises infrared heating body 331, solar panel 332 and light shield 333, described solar panel 332 is provided with steam vent 334, infrared heating body 331 is arranged between solar panel 332 and light shield 333, described light shield 333 is provided with light hole 335, described solar panel 332 is circular arc burnishing surface, described light hole 335 inwall is also burnishing surface, described infrared temperature detector 34 comprises 4 temperature detectors 341 up and down, and described infrared temperature detector 34 can detect by the temperature at heated components four angles up and down, when returning separately after described end-cap fixture 1 and body fixture 2 in advance docking, at this moment described infrared heating device 33 is driven by heater removable drive 31 and moves forward on heater guide rail 32, light hole 335 is made to aim at soldering part surface, the infrared light of infrared heating body 331 is by after solar panel 332 light gathering reflector, being radiated at soldering part surface by light hole 335 makes it melt, described steam vent 334 is ventilated in infrared heater 33 simultaneously, gas is discharged from light hole 335 again, can prevent the dirty gas produced in the process of heated components from entering from light hole 335 luminosity that infrared heater 33 affects infrared heating body 331 like this, also heated components can be made to be heated evenly, heat complete infrared heater 33 to retreat and make infrared temperature detector 34 aim at soldering part melted surface to carry out temperature detection, after detected temperatures reaches predetermined temperature, infrared heater 33 is driven by heater driver 31 and returns to initial position, complete heating action, at this moment welding action is carried out in end-cap fixture 1 and body fixture 2 docking, when detected temperatures does not reach predetermined temperature, infrared heater 33 drives the position getting back to heating to continue heating by heater driver 31, and then carry out temperature detection by infrared temperature detector 34, until detected temperatures reach predetermined temperature after infrared heater 33 return, then carry out welding action.
